Select Page

Case Study

Migrated available data on client's server to Azure

Client Background

The client is provider of bio-instrumentation products including physiological monitors and patient-centered diagnostic and therapy systems.

Client Need

  • The client has dev servers, staging servers, production servers, and database servers on-premise. They wanted the whole setup to be migrated to Azure. Dev, Staging, Production WEB and DB servers.
  • Needed the new setup to have high availability as well as ready for disaster recovery.

Our Solution

  • Deployed the application to app-service in Azure (PaaS) using the PowerShell scripts
  • Took the backup of the on-premise database and restored it to Azure SQL Database.
  • Performed disaster recovery procedures on the database and made the database available in different regions through geo-replication.
  • Performed continuous integration and deployment to different environments in the Azure Cloud.
  • Managed the application’s traffic by using traffic manager in Azure.

Key Benefits

  • An application with high availability even during peak time.
  • Automatic failover is available for the database in case of any disaster.
  • No manual setup and monitoring of the servers required as the same is handled by Azure.
  • The client can monitor both the web and DB server status in Azure.
  • The application’s load is balanced by the traffic manager.

Tools & Technologies

Microsoft Azure
Powershell
SQL

Services

Digital Product Engineering

Cloud Services

Data & Analytics

AI and Automation
Cybersecurity
Modern Managed Services

Build Operate Transfer

Innova Orion GCC Services

Talent Solutions

Industries

Communications & Media

Government Solutions

Healthcare, Life Sciences,
and Insurance

Banking & Financial Services

Energy, Oil & Gas and Utilities

Hi-Tech

Retail & CPG
Manufacturing

Travel & Transportation and Hospitality

Partnerships

AWS

Automation Anywhere

Databricks

Google

IBM

Microsoft

Pega

Salesforce

SAP
ServiceNow

Snowflake

Uipath

Innovation @ Work

Blogs and Insights

Research and Whitepapers

Case Studies

Podcasts

Webinars & Tech Talks
US Employment Reports

Company

About Us

Leadership Team

Strategic Partnerships

Office Locations

Newsroom

Events

ESG

The Innova Foundation

Careers

Explore Open Positions

Life @ Innova Solutions

Candidate Resource Library

Let's Connect